  • Patent number: 5003002
    Abstract: An oxygen barrier blend for use in containers requiring good oxygen barrier properties which comprises more than 70% of an ethylene vinyl alcohol copolymer and the balance an amorphous nylon having no melting point. Such a blend is used in a laminate structure which can be thermoformed into such oxygen barrier containers.

  • Patent number: 4728275
    Abstract: Multi-bladed disc cutter for cutting into pellets thermoplastic material extruded from a die plate of an underwater pelletizer, wherein the blades of the cutter are integrally formed on the periphery of a backplate and radially project therefrom, the sidewalls of the blades being integrally connected by shroud members to provide added strength against bending and twisting of the blades under load. Perforations are provided in the shroud members and backplate to permit passage of water to cool and flush away the cut pellets. Additionally, integrally formed blades may be arranged in concentric circles inwardly of the periphery of the backplate. The integral of the disc cutters avoids weakening and misalignment of the blades, saves space and permits a greater number of cutting edges than is possible in disc cutters wherein the blades are fastened to a hole by bolts. Casting the cutter integrally with its blades permits off-line grinding for final alignment purposes.

  • Patent number: 4485210
    Abstract: A continuous process for producing star-block copolymer of a monovinyl aromatic monomer and a conjugated diene by continuously forming a vinyl aromatic polymer having a low weight average molecular weight to number average molecular weight ratio in a first reactor by anionic initiation in a solution of inert solvent; discharging a solution of polymer from the first reactor and passing the solution to a second sealed, cylindrical, pressurized, vertical reactor having a bottom zone, top zone and a plurality of intermediate zones separated by separation plates, each having a central aperture and mixing shaft passing therethrough, with the mixture passing to successive zones through an annular space formed between the shaft and each separation plate.

  • Patent number: 4442273
    Abstract: A process and apparatus for the continuous polymerization of monovinyl aromatic monomers, such as styrene, to produce a substantially monodisperse polymer, wherein a solution of monomer in an inert solvent and a hydrocarbyllithium initiator are fed to the bottom zone of a sealed, cylindrical, pressurized, vertical reactor having a plurality of zones, with separation plates separating the reactor into a bottom, a plurality of intermediate, and top zones, the separation plates each having a central aperture, and a mixing means for each zone has a shaft extending through the apertures to provide an annular space for flow of fluid through the zones, the annular space between each separation plate and the shaft of the mixing means being of a size to provide a pressure differential between adjacent zones of less than about one pound per square inch, a substantially monodisperse polymer in solution discharged from the top zone of the reactor.
